POSITION SUMMARY

Our jobs aren’t just about setting up tables and chairs for our guests to use during a banquet or meeting. Instead, we want to create an atmosphere that is memorable and unique. Our Event Support Experts take the initiative and deliver a wide range of services that allow our events to go off without a hitch. Whether setting up and breaking down materials, transporting supplies, stocking bars and action stations, or anything in between, the Event Support Expert plays a key role in making our events run flawlessly.

No matter what position you are in, there are a few things that are critical to success – creating a safe workplace, following company policies and procedures, upholding quality standards, and ensuring your uniform, personal appearance, and communications are professional. Event Support Experts will be on their feet and moving around (stand, sit, or walk for an extended time) and taking a hands-on approach to work (move, lift, carry, push, pull, and place objects weighing less than or equal to 50 pounds without assistance and objects weighing in excess of 75 pounds with assistance). Doing all these things well (and other reasonable job duties as requested) is critical – to get it right for our guests and our business each and every time.

P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S

Education: High school diploma or G.E.D. equivalent.

Related Work Experience: Less than 1 year related work experience.

Supervisory Experience: No supervisory experience.

License or Certification: None

Some tips for your application 🫡

Understand the Role: Read the job description carefully to understand the responsibilities and expectations of a Conference & Banqueting Waiter/Waitress. Highlight your ability to create memorable experiences for guests in your application.

Tailor Your CV: Make sure your CV reflects relevant experience, even if it's less than a year. Emphasise any customer service roles or events you’ve worked at, showcasing your skills in creating a welcoming atmosphere.

Craft a Strong Cover Letter: Write a cover letter that expresses your enthusiasm for the role and the company. Mention specific qualities that make you a good fit, such as your ability to work in a team and your commitment to high standards of service.

Proofread Your Application: Before submitting, double-check your application for spelling and grammatical errors. A polished application reflects your attention to detail, which is crucial in the hospitality industry.

How to prepare for a job interview at Leicester Marriott Hotel

✨Show Your Enthusiasm for Hospitality

Make sure to express your passion for the hospitality industry during the interview. Share experiences where you went above and beyond to create a memorable experience for guests, as this aligns with the company's commitment to 'Wonderful Hospitality. Always.'

✨Demonstrate Teamwork Skills

Since the role involves working closely with others, highlight your ability to collaborate effectively. Provide examples of how you've worked in a team setting to ensure events run smoothly, showcasing your communication and interpersonal skills.

✨Prepare for Physical Demands

Be ready to discuss your ability to handle the physical aspects of the job, such as lifting and moving items. You might want to mention any relevant experience that demonstrates your capability to meet these demands, ensuring you're seen as a reliable candidate.

✨Dress Professionally

First impressions matter! Dress in smart, professional attire for your interview to reflect the high standards of the hospitality industry. This shows that you understand the importance of personal appearance and professionalism in the role.
